PERFLUORO(ETHYLCYCLOHEXANE), with the chemical formula C8F14C6H11, is a fluorinated organic compound. It is characterized as a colorless, odorless liquid that is insoluble in water and exhibits high volatility. This substance is recognized for its high thermal stability, low toxicity, and resistance to chemical and biological degradation, making it a versatile chemical for various applications.

335-21-7 Usage

Uses

Used in Heat Transfer Applications:
PERFLUORO(ETHYLCYCLOHEXANE) is utilized as a heat transfer fluid due to its high thermal stability, which allows it to maintain its properties under high-temperature conditions without breaking down.
Used in Cleaning and Degreasing Applications:
In the cleaning and degreasing industry, PERFLUORO(ETHYLCYCLOHEXANE) serves as a solvent. Its ability to dissolve various substances makes it effective for removing grease, oil, and other contaminants from surfaces.
However, due to concerns regarding its environmental persistence and potential health effects, the use of PERFLUORO(ETHYLCYCLOHEXANE) is increasingly being regulated. It is crucial to handle and dispose of this chemical in accordance with proper safety and environmental guidelines to mitigate any adverse impacts.

Check Digit Verification of cas no

The CAS Registry Mumber 335-21-7 includes 6 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 3 digits, 3,3 and 5 respectively; the second part has 2 digits, 2 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 335-21:
(5*3)+(4*3)+(3*5)+(2*2)+(1*1)=47
47 % 10 = 7
So 335-21-7 is a valid CAS Registry Number.
